#ifndef _ARM_ACPI_MACHDEP_H
#define _ARM_ACPI_MACHDEP_H
struct acpi_softc;
ACPI_STATUS acpi_md_OsInitialize(void);
ACPI_PHYSICAL_ADDRESS acpi_md_OsGetRootPointer(void);
ACPI_STATUS acpi_md_OsInstallInterruptHandler(UINT32, ACPI_OSD_HANDLER,
void *, void **, const char *);
void acpi_md_OsRemoveInterruptHandler(void *);
ACPI_STATUS acpi_md_OsMapMemory(ACPI_PHYSICAL_ADDRESS, UINT32, void **);
void acpi_md_OsUnmapMemory(void *, UINT32);
ACPI_STATUS acpi_md_OsGetPhysicalAddress(void *, ACPI_PHYSICAL_ADDRESS *);
BOOLEAN acpi_md_OsReadable(void *, UINT32);
BOOLEAN acpi_md_OsWritable(void *, UINT32);
void acpi_md_OsEnableInterrupt(void);
void acpi_md_OsDisableInterrupt(void);
void * acpi_md_intr_establish(uint32_t, int, int, int (*)(void *),
void *, bool, const char *);
void acpi_md_intr_mask(void *);
void acpi_md_intr_unmask(void *);
void acpi_md_intr_disestablish(void *);
int acpi_md_sleep(int);
uint32_t acpi_md_pdc(void);
uint32_t acpi_md_ncpus(void);
void acpi_md_callback(struct acpi_softc *);
static inline int
_acpi_notimpl(const char *fn)
{
printf("WARNING: ACPI function %s not implemented on this platform\n", fn);
return 0;
}
#define acpi_md_OsIn8(x) _acpi_notimpl("acpi_md_OsIn8")
#define acpi_md_OsIn16(x) _acpi_notimpl("acpi_md_OsIn16")
#define acpi_md_OsIn32(x) _acpi_notimpl("acpi_md_OsIn32")
#define acpi_md_OsOut8(x, v) (void)_acpi_notimpl("acpi_md_OsOut8")
#define acpi_md_OsOut16(x, v) (void)_acpi_notimpl("acpi_md_OsOut16")
#define acpi_md_OsOut32(x, v) (void)_acpi_notimpl("acpi_md_OsOut32")
#endif /* !_ARM_ACPI_MACHDEP_H */
